Hanna Stamps is releasing a new line of stamps featuring an adorable little moose named Riley. They are wood-mounted red rubber....and they stamp like a dream! A total of six new Riley images will be released on February 1st---this image is called 'Easter Chick Riley'. I used Basic Grey's 'Oh Baby Girl' line of DP since it reminds me of the beautiful, soft colors seen in little girl's frilly Easter dresses. I added a ribbon blossom to each side of the sentiment and gave the eggs & baby chick some 'bling' with my clear Spica pen.


Stamps: Easter Chick Riley-by Hanna Stamps; Papertrey sentiment.
Paper: GP white CS, Basic Grey-Oh Baby Girl DP, Lovely Lilac.
Ink: Gable Green, Pretty in Pink, Lovely Lilac.
Accessories: Copic markers, clear Spica pen, ticket corner punch, brads, ribbon, dimensionals, sponge daubers.
